Phone number ☎️ 01202137311 👆 is reported as a persistent nuisance associated with unsolicited calls about loft or wall insulation, often delivered via automated messages or scripted sales pitches. Callers, frequently using the names Matthew or Chris, claim to offer surveys, government grants, or highlight alleged issues like mould, condensation, or faulty installation to pressure recipients, typically targeting older individuals. Calls often originate from numbers with the Bournemouth area code and may change slightly each time. Recipients report silent calls, hang-ups upon questioning, or being unable to call back. Multiple users highlight the potential scam nature, advising caution, ignoring calls, blocking the number, and warning against sharing personal details. This number is widely believed to be linked to deceptive sales tactics and should be treated with scepticism.

About 01 Numbers
The indicated numbers refer to specific locations in the UK and are typically used by domestic and commercial premises. Frequently termed as 'basic rate', 'local rate', or 'national rate' numbers, the costs for these geographic numbers are contingent on the time of day. Several service providers offer call packages that offer free calls during certain times. Call costs from mobile phones are according to the chosen calling plan, with many plans offering these numbers in their free call packages.
